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7926688364 1533 1499 933407
9463 3258
9463 3258
8738953 7064 41566251
All about undefined
Interested in learning more?
9463 3258
8738953 7064 41566251
See more
5387353 7573
680693917 09655 211 32 040182
See more
6179 670 70416214
539247003 900672 6161839 2275
See more